Responsibilities
- Take charge of the regional transport function and ensure it runs like clockwork.
- Serve as the immediate line manager for drivers: allocate work, deliver instructions, monitor progress, and check that all tasks are completed by day end.
- Handle any grievance or disciplinary matters.
- Maintain excellence in vehicle maintenance and driver checks, striving for constant general improvement and increased profitability.
- Manage people, keep accurate records, and deal with queries and problems.
- Apply knowledge of the waste or transport industry and good numerical skills.
